[/QUOTE] Passenger wheel, lower splash guard, serpentine belt, W/P pulley, crank pulley then water pump. Those all have to come off, the coolant should be drained before hand though. [QUOTE] It's not that bad of a job... But yes the Timing belt needs to come off along with the Timing Belt Tensioner... It is a good 4-5 Hour Job... But hey it always seems to take longer than called for in a book... Enjoy
